Extrapulmonary dirofilariasis, a rare infection by the dog heartworm Dirofilaria immitis, is highlighted by a case of asymptomatic abdominal nodules. This report expands understanding of this unusual parasitic infection beyond the lungs.

Area of Science:

  • Parasitology
  • Infectious Diseases
  • Human Pathology

Background:

  • Human infections with Dirofilaria immitis, commonly known as dog heartworm, are well-documented, primarily affecting the lungs.
  • Extrapulmonary dirofilariasis is significantly rarer, with limited documented cases globally and particularly in North America.

Observation:

  • A case of extrapulmonary dirofilariasis is presented, characterized by asymptomatic nodular lesions in the anterior abdominal wall.
  • The patient underwent exploratory laparotomy for an unrelated carcinoma, revealing the unexpected parasitic manifestation.

Findings:

  • This case represents one of the few documented instances of extrapulmonary dirofilariasis in North America.
  • The findings contribute to the understanding of the varied clinical presentations of Dirofilaria immitis infection.

Implications:

  • The report underscores the importance of considering dirofilariasis in the differential diagnosis of unexplained nodular lesions, even in extrapulmonary sites.
  • Further research into the pathophysiology and diagnostic challenges of extrapulmonary dirofilariasis is warranted.
